High Throughput Screening of the Thermal Stability of Colorants in a Polycarbonate Matrix

The relative thermal stability of 44 colorants of interest to GE Plastics as polymer colorants was determined. The effects of common (non-colorant) additives on the thermal stability in a polymer matrix were also determined. The measurements were carried out by reflectance spectrometry on thin films of polymers that had been subjected to heating cycles. The change in the visible spectrum was used as an indicator of thermal stability. This paper discusses the method and overall results for the experiments.
